when you install the game it adds a whole lot of shit to the registry. without it the game doesn't work.

why didn't the faggots use an ini file, i have no idea, but the thing is, once you fuck that up you're screwed.

you can try looking for this stuff with regedit.
[H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Will\yumemirukusuri]

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all\{03ABC33C-10B1-400E-B1FA-E81
7FE98D11C}]

[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Peach Princess\YUME MIRU KUSURI\1.00.0000]

[HKEY_USERS\S-1-5-21-299502267-1383384898-1801674531-1003\Software\Will\yumemirukusuri]

and deleting them after a backup, maybe that'll make the game realise it's not installed anymore and allow you to reinstall.
